The V-Series' measurement accuracy makes it an industry leader in three areas: lowest oscilloscope noise level, minimal real-time oscilloscope jitter, and maximum effective bit count. Thanks to a process based on an indium phosphide (InP) integrated circuit, these advantages allow developers to see highly accurate representations of their signals, thus benefiting from tighter design margins.
To help engineers pinpoint and debug the most complex problems, the V-Series offers 12.5 Gbps hardware serial triggering (HWST) with a 160-bit sequence—the highest on the market. It is currently the only HWST capable of locating 132-bit (128b/132b) USB 3.1 or 130-bit (128b/130b) PCIe® Gen 3 symbols. The V Series also offers the fastest mixed-signal oscilloscope on the market, with 20 Gmu/s digital channels, ideal for triggering, analyzing, and debugging DDR4 and LPDDR4 buses.
“The V-Series ensures rapid validation and debugging, whether the designer is seeking answers across multiple lanes or a highly parallel bus,” explained Dave Cipriani, vice president and general manager of Keysight’s Oscilloscope and Protocol Division. “By choosing the V-Series, R&D labs in today’s most competitive industries will have everything they need to get more data, faster.” In addition, for high-performance probe-tip measurements, Keysight will also be introducing the new InfiniiMax III+ N7000A Series high-speed probe solutions, ranging from 8 to 20 GHz. These probe solutions feature InfiniiMode, which allows for convenient measurement of differential, unipolar, and common-mode signals with a single connection and probe tip.
This capability complements the existing InfiniiMax III N2800A Series 30 GHz wideband differential probe solutions. In addition, the new N7010A active termination adapter, designed for HDMI 2.0, DisplayPort, and MIPI™ M-PHY Gear 3 and 4 applications, offers ultra-low noise voltage termination (with adjustable voltage ranges from -4V to +4V) for signals.
